About this tour
Trace Mary Stuart's turbulent life across the Scottish Lowlands on this eight-hour private minivan tour from Edinburgh. Visit the castles, palaces and estates where this Catholic queen was born, ruled and eventually faced her downfall at the hands of Protestant England. Your local guide unpicks the religious and political tensions that made Mary a threat to Elizabeth I, drawing on primary sources and lesser-known details to bring Renaissance Scotland to life. The Mercedes minivan navigates narrow country roads to reach sites inaccessible by coach, keeping the group intimate and the atmosphere reflective.

What to expect
You'll spend the day moving between several locations within an hour's drive of Edinburgh, each tied to different chapters of Mary's story. The guide contextualises each site within the broader religious upheaval of 16th-century Britain, explaining why her claim to the English throne alarmed Elizabeth I. Expect to walk gently around grounds and enter some buildings; pacing is relaxed and the minivan is your base between stops. You'll hear period detail and human drama rather than dry dates. The journey itself—through rolling countryside—forms part of the experience, offering a sense of the landscape Mary knew.
